Figured I'd post up some more bits about Force. For starters, the keys...
-D-Pad, L-Stick, and the four face buttons are the same as always. As a note, there are only two sub-weapons this time: Square + Triangle and Square + X. I always felt like Triangle + X was too hard to do on the PSP (which is why I remapped the controls for Next Plus), so I guess Bandai agreed.
-L activates Command Mode, where you can order around CPU allies.
-R is a "Shift" button, like in A.C.E. R + Square and R + Triangle are alternate inputs for Sub-Weapons 1 and 2, R + Circle puts you in Free Camera Mode, and R + X is an alternate input for Guard (the website lists the main input as Up, Down; I can't help but wonder if this is a typo).
-R-Stick cycles through targets when you're in Lock On Mode and controls the camera in Free Camera Mode.

Now some movelists. I put these in spoiler text just to save space. You'll notice that Assists have been nixed completely.

InjuredPelican wrote:I saw somewhere that both FAZZ and ZZ Enhanced are in the game, just like Maxi Boost. Which is good cause I kinda like Enhanced ZZ better.
Actually, let me clarify this: The original ZZ is in Maxi as a separate unit from the Full Armor ZZ. The Enhanced ZZ is the form that the Full Armor assumes when you dump the armor (and thus it's in Full Boost as well). The main differences:
-Base ZZ is 2500 compared to FA/Enhanced's 3000, so it has fewer HP and lower damage.
-Base ZZ has the same basic moveset as the Enhanced's, but they have different Assists: ZZ has Puru's Qubeley while Enhanced has the Zeta Zaku.
-Base ZZ can charge the high mega cannon up to three levels, like the Sekiha Tenkyoken.
-Base ZZ can perform a separate attack like the Force Impulse, during which it can attack with the beam saber or high mega cannon. Enhanced can swap into Full Armor and vice-versa.
-Base ZZ can transform into the G-Fortress, the first time it's been able to do so in the Vs. Series.
-Base ZZ's melee set is less varied than the Enhanced but better than the Full Armor.
-Base ZZ's Burst is a full power high mega cannon, while Enhanced and Full Armor's are the giant beam saber as in Full Boost.

As for both versions being in Force...no clue yet. We'll have to wait and see.
